  • Title Crítica a la antropología perspectivista. Viveiros de Castro – Philippe Descola – Bruno Latour
    Author Carlos Reynoso
    Publisher Sb editorial
    Imprint Sb editorial
    ISBN 9789871984114
    Edition number 1
    Publication year 2019
    Pages 312
    Format Printed
    THEMA Social & cultural anthropology
    Synopsis Under the name of “Amerindian perspectivism”, both the multinaturalism of Brazilian anthropologist Eduardo Viveiros de Castro and the animism of Frenchman Philippe Descola have become popular. This book brings to light the flaws that run through the theoretical models of perspectivism and the misunderstandings that affect its appropriation of scientific and mathematical concepts that have not been fully understood.

  • Title El vértigo horizontal
    Author Villoro, Juan
    Publisher Almadía Ediciones, S. A. P. I. de C. V.
    Imprint Almadia
    ISBN 9786078764761
    Edition number 1
    Publication year 2022
    Pages 456
    Format Printed
    THEMA Fiction and Related items
    Synopsis Convinced that Mexico City may not be the most advisable region to live in, but also that it is so intricate and exciting that it is impossible to leave it, Juan Villoro proposes this book written from the devotion of the recalcitrant and amazed urbanite that unfolds like an infinite puzzle: the shortcuts, the wrestling movies, the national heroes, the Tepiteño commerce, the government paperwork, the enigma of the tire repair shops, the countless crowds, the consumption of chili, the ancestral temples. The author also narrates certain autobiographical passages, such as the last walk with his grandmother or the memory of the neighborhood of abandoned houses where he grew up. With an attentive gaze and a firm pulse, Villoro unfolds as a journalist, passerby, pen buyer, nostalgic adult, responsible father, emergency brigade member, and offers us a testimony of the multiple adventures that the city has in store for each and every one of its members. Whether from his own experience or through listening to and investigating other people's realities, Juan Villoro composes a great fresco of the endearing and eternal chaos that makes up the country's capital. The space in which nothing fits anymore, but nothing is ever left over: Chilangópolis.

  • Title No fue penal
    Author Villoro, Juan
    Publisher Almadía Ediciones, S. A. P. I. de C. V.
    Imprint Almadia
    ISBN 9786078851508
    Edition number 1
    Publication year 2023
    Pages 104
    Format Printed
    THEMA Fiction and Related items
    Synopsis It Wasn't a Penalty offers two versions of the same play. In dramatic fashion, this move brings together two friends whom fate has turned into enemies. El Tanque is the manager of a team that will be relegated to the second division if they lose the match. From his small prison as a technical director, he faces something more than the score: his future and his past are at stake. With his throat torn to pieces, he fights against the clumsiness of his own players and the decisions of the referee. Meanwhile, he is observed by Valeriano Fuentes, the former friend with whom he shared a tragedy that changed their lives and who is now in charge of the implacable justice of the VAR. For years, Juan Villoro, winner of the Manuel Vázquez Montalbán International Award for Dios es redondo, has written chronicles and essays on football. This time he uses two complementary narratives to tell a story about sporting passion, brotherhood and rivalries, and to explore the theatrical condition of those who intervene in the game from off the field. Controversial plays depend on who watches them. It Wasn't a Penalty brings to light a disconcerting condition of sport: what is legitimate for some is an insult for others. The match is stopped and the action is reviewed by the VAR. What will be the verdict? Two very different stories explain this disturbing moment of decision.

  • Title ¡Qué chamacos tan teatreros!
    Author Berta Hiriart (compiladora)
    Publisher SM México
    Imprint Informativos
    ISBN 9786072402553
    Edition number 1
    Publication year 2012
    Pages 292
    Format Printed
    THEMA Children’s, Teenage
    Synopsis Here are four contemporary theatrical pieces of the highest quality, aimed at children from seven years of age to read them, act them, play with them or simply enjoy the result of others bringing them to the stage. "Vote for the Lion", by Antonio Malpica and Javier Malpica, is a funny comedy that starts when the animals of the jungle decide that the king is no longer useful, that the ruler must be changed; "Do you know how to whistle? "by Ulf Stark, is a tender story of extremes coming together: a boy and an old man adopt each other as grandfather and grandson; "Los sueños de Paco", by Carlos Corona, is a half humorous, half touching play that tells how a boy goes through the hard separation from his parents; finally, "Tokoloshe" is a nice South African play that tells how a little girl, even in the hardest adversities, can believe in magic, believe in a friend always ready to help. This volume is designed for professional or amateur theater groups, or for simple school plays. Each piece is preceded by an introduction and useful guidelines for staging with children.
